Stream: Cash Valley Run Cash Valley Run
Stream Order: 1
County: Allegany
Location: Near Cumberland, MD
Lat/Long: N.A.
Ownership: SHA/County
Point of Contact: Graig Hartsock: craig.hartsock@md.nacdnet.net
Structure Type: Sulvert
Type of Passage: Pool & Weir
Miles of Habitat Reopened: Less than 1
Target Species: Brook Trout
Construction Start Date: Summer 2007
Completion Date: Summer 2007
Comments Alan Klotz, regional biologist has identified this site as critical for opening up habitat for brook trout. Well established population downstream of culvert, Cash Valley Run serves as a “seed” river for Braddock Run. Money has been secured for a design through the Highland Actions Plan.
